    Hey,hope someone out there can help me!!I downloaded family guy the movie from limewire. Its come on to the pc as a windows media file.I can only play it on windows media,which has the facility to burn but only to audio cd and nero wont let me burn it to a dvd to watch on my home dvd player.The file type shows as video clip and description of file is dvd rip also says (tmd) but not sure what that means Im really confused!!any advice??

    TMD(the movie destination) has the crappiest downloads and 9x out of 10 they are the worst quality.

    Windows media video files are commonly called wmv.

    You will need to use a wmv to mpeg2 converter and then once the file is converted you should not have a problem using nero to burn it to dvd disc
